Firemen Receive Service Awards
Several members of the Shannon Volunteer Mre Brigade were presented with service awards by the Mayor, Mr. D. A. Fitzgerald, at the annual ball of "the brigade,' held in the Druids' Hall last Thursday evening. Prior to presenting the awards, Mr. Fitzgerald extended congratulations to the brigade on the excellent voluntary work which members were so ably carrying out. * Theirs was a duty which served the community, and the people of Shannon were proud of their fire brigade and those men who gave their services to safeguard homes and property. He concluded by extending congra- s tulations to the brigade on another successful year and those members who were being honoured for their long service. Mr. Fitzgerald then called upon the foliowing members to come forward and receive their awards; — Bar to five-year medal: Superintendent C. D. Gyde, Deputy Superintendent F. Clough, Secretary C. Tremewan, Firemen W. Clough, G. McEwen, D. . Richards, W. S. Forbes, N. Richards and C. G. Wishart. Foreman K. Clough was awarded a three-year certifieate. The trophy for the snooker competition was won this year by Mr. C. D. Gyde and. inE. making "this presentation 'tlie ikayor Tremarked on the social side of the brigade's activities. Superintendent Gyde, replying on behalf of the brigade, expressed the sincere thanks of members to the Mayor for attending and making the presentations and to the public for their support. . A number of visiting brigadesmen yere present at the function.
